A private French teacher can teach you about the topics of French that may be causing you difficulty as you learn on your own or in a classroom setting. For example, some learners, who are fluent in English, struggle with the gendered nouns of the French language. Unlike English, French nouns are either masculine or feminine. Learning about these nouns takes practice and memorization, which a private instructor can assist you with. There are many reasons why a student may be interested in learning French. Perhaps they are studying literature and want to read French texts, or maybe they are a high school student who wants to get ahead in their French class. It is even possible that an individual wants to learn French to gain acceptance to a collegiate study abroad program, or they want to expand their career options in the international job market. Some people may even want to learn French just for fun! Learning French can benefit people in many ways, and can also help people learn other languages down the road.
